Output 308b87d309594a75243667f6b6eca4e25cf04cfe079c190618cd0a38b9edbb19:1

value
14302
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d4424a9ae5a13dfd8068e8d5e656effa2e545a940c3104e70989c2d2ac665d13
address
bc1p63py4xh95y7lmqrgar27v4h0lgh9gk55pscsfecf38pd9trxt5fsj5nm7l
transaction
308b87d309594a75243667f6b6eca4e25cf04cfe079c190618cd0a38b9edbb19
confirmations
25634
spent
true